使用V2Ray结合Cloudflare实现HTTPS代理的完整指南

引言

在现代网络环境中,网络安全与隐私保护越来越受到重视。V2Ray是一个强大的网络代理工具,它可以帮助用户实现安全的网络连接。结合Cloudflare的服务,用户可以更好地保障自己的数据安全,避免被追踪。本文将详细介绍如何使用V2Ray结合Cloudflare实现HTTPS代理,并回答一些常见问题。

V2Ray是什么?

V2Ray是一个多用途的网络代理工具,旨在提高网络的安全性和隐私保护。它能够支持多种协议,包括VMess、Shadowsocks等,具有灵活的配置和强大的功能。

Cloudflare是什么?

Cloudflare是一家提供网络安全和性能优化服务的公司。其服务包括内容分发网络(CDN)、DDoS防护、域名解析等。使用Cloudflare可以显著提高网站的访问速度,同时增强安全性。

使用V2Ray结合Cloudflare的优势

  • 安全性提升:通过Cloudflare的加密技术,数据传输更加安全。
  • 隐私保护:用户的真实IP地址得以隐藏,保护用户隐私。
  • 访问控制Cloudflare可以根据用户的需求设置访问权限,提供更好的管理功能。

准备工作

在开始之前,需要确保以下条件:

  1. V2Ray服务端:你需要一个已搭建好的V2Ray服务端。
  2. Cloudflare账户:注册并登录Cloudflare账户。
  3. 域名:需要一个已通过Cloudflare的域名。

安装和配置V2Ray

1. 安装V2Ray

首先,你需要在你的服务器上安装V2Ray。可以通过以下命令快速安装: bash bash <(curl -s -L https://git.io/v2ray.sh)

2. 配置V2Ray

在安装完成后,需要修改配置文件。一般配置文件位于/etc/v2ray/config.json

  • 修改V2Ray的监听地址为Cloudflare提供的域名。
  • 配置VMessShadowsocks协议,确保能与客户端连接。

3. 启动V2Ray

完成配置后,可以通过以下命令启动V2Ray服务: bash systemctl start v2ray

配置Cloudflare

1. 添加域名到Cloudflare

登录你的Cloudflare账户,添加你的域名并选择DNS管理

2. 配置DNS记录

添加一条A记录,将你的域名指向V2Ray服务器的IP地址。确保此记录启用Cloudflare的代理服务(橙色云朵状态)。

3. 配置SSL/TLS设置

Cloudflare控制面板中,找到SSL/TLS选项,确保SSL模式设置为“全加密”或“完全加密(严格)”。

客户端配置

使用V2Ray的客户端,配置连接信息:

  • 服务器地址:输入Cloudflare域名。
  • 端口号:填写V2Ray服务端的端口。
  • 用户ID:使用你的V2Ray配置文件中的用户ID。

常见问题解答 (FAQ)

Q1: V2Ray如何确保安全性?

A1: V2Ray使用加密协议来保障数据传输的安全,此外还可以配置多种混淆方式以增强隐私保护。

Q2: 如何解决连接失败的问题?

A2: 如果连接失败,首先检查V2Ray服务是否正常运行,确认域名解析正确,同时检查防火墙设置是否放行相关端口。

Q3: 为什么要使用Cloudflare?

A3: 使用Cloudflare可以提升网站的加载速度,同时提供更好的安全防护,有效抵御DDoS攻击。

Q4: 如何监控V2Ray流量?

A4: 可以通过V2Ray的日志功能监控流量,此外也可以使用网络流量分析工具。

Q5: 有没有免费的V2Ray服务推荐?

A5: 一些提供V2Ray服务的商家可能会提供免费试用,但长期使用建议选择可靠的付费服务。

结论

结合V2RayCloudflare使用HTTPS代理是保护网络安全与隐私的有效方式。通过正确的配置,用户可以享受到更加安全的网络环境。希望本文能帮助你成功搭建V2RayCloudflare的服务。如有疑问,欢迎留言交流。

正文完